Neuware - Architecture and Control makes a collective critical intervention into the relationship between architecture, including virtual architectures, and practices of control since the turn of the twentieth to twenty-first centuries. Authors from the fields of architectural theory, literature, film and cultural studies come together here with visual artists to explore the contested sites at which, in the present day, attempts at gaining control give rise to architectures of control as well as the potential for architectures of resistance. Together, these contributions make clear how a variety of post-2000 architectures enable control to be established, all the while observing how certain architectures and infrastructures allow for alternative, progressive modes of control, and even modes of the unforeseen and the uncontrolled, to arise.Contributors are: Pablo Bustinduy, Rafael Dernbach, Alexander R. Galloway, Hans Ulrich Gumbrecht, Maria Finn, Runa Johannessen, Natalie Koerner, Michael Krause, Samantha Martin-McAuliffe, Lorna Muir, Mikkel Bolt Rasmussen, Anne Elisabeth Sejten and Joey Whitfield.

Very exciting provenance to this particular example indicated by antiquarian lending label from the Theosophical Society, Bowden Lodge at Beech Villa on Stamford Road. Bowdon lies within the historic boundaries of county Cheshire, and became part of Greater Manchester in 1974. Features the society's multi-symboled emblem of ouroboros with variety of ankh and hexagram at center, and above this, the ancient fylfot and 3 or Hindu "Om" symbol. Motto below emblem is "Satyan nasti paro dharmah"; Sanskrit translating to: "There is no religion higher than truth," or "Nothing is greater than truth." The motto of the society was adopted from the Rajas of Benares. This would have been in the Theosophical Society's collection following Steiner's departure and beginning of Anthroposophy movement. "The personality of Rudolf Steiner and his development. He is both a true occultist and a true mystic. His real initiator." - Edouard Schure. "Steiner's views represent a deeply mystical Christian Theosophy and are of great utility. He is the natural heir to the German mystics, and adds to their profound spirituality the fine lucidity of a philosophic mind." - Annie Besant. Summaries: Chapter I. The Superficial World and Its Gnosis: How we may attain knowledge of ourselves. All have the same rights, the same liberty. During the nineteenth century, civilization has moved along physical lines. Higher powers are only developed on planes higher than the physical. How can one attain to superphysical truths, and of what help are spiritual powers. Chapter II. How to Attain Knowledge of Higher Worlds: Everyone has latent faculties by means of which they may acquire knowledge of the Higher Worlds. The development of these faculties. He who strives earnestly after higher knowledge need not be afraid of any difficulty or obstacle in his search for an Initiate who shall be able to lead him into the profounder secrets of the world. The opening of the spiritual eyes. Chapter III. The Path of Discipleship: How to distinguish between the real and unreal. Those who really know are always the most modest. Man and spirit can be united. Why man knows nothing of those experiences which lie beyond the borders of Birth and Death. How we may obtain such knowledge. The Occult Science the means of developing the spiritual ears and eyes and kindling the spiritual sight. Chapter IV. Probation: The dawing of the spiritual world, the so-called astral plane. Chapter V. Enlightenment: Enlightenment is a matter of developing certain feelings and thoughts which are dormant within all men but must be awakened. The inner illumination. The golden rule of true Occultism. What we have to do before we are initiated into the higher mysteries. Chapter VI. Initiation: The highest stages in an occult scholl of which it is possible to speak in a book. The Initiation. The Temple of Higher Wisdom. The Three Trials; Fire-Trail, Water-Trial, Air-Trial. Chapter VII. The Higher Education of the Soul: The culture of the soul and spirit. Chapter VIII. The Conditions of Discipleship: Everyone can receive occult training if they are willing to fulfill the claims which are put forward by the occult teacher. Note: Dr. Steiner gives advice and makes statements which are based on his own personal experience which makes his works very valuable.
